Why doesn't Venus have a moon? A new study may have the answer
Venus likely lost a natural satellite after tidal forces destroyed it following an orbital process that lasted one billion seven hundred million years. This moon potentially orbited the planet for nearly 2 billion years before disappearing. Researchers are using this model to explain the lack of a lunar companion for Venus, contrasting it with Earth. While Venus and Earth share similar mass, composition, and size, their divergent lunar histories highlight different evolutionary paths for the two planets.

Tidal forces may have destroyed an ancient moon of Venus
Venus currently lacks a moon, but a new study suggests tidal forces may have destroyed a natural satellite that once orbited the planet. This ancient moon potentially existed for nearly 2 billion years before its disappearance. The research proposes an orbital process lasting one billion seven hundred million years that eventually led to the loss of the satellite. Scientists are now using these findings to explain why Venus differs from Earth in its lack of a lunar companion.
Why it matters
The presence or absence of moons affects a planet's stability and rotation. Understanding why Venus lost its satellite helps astronomers compare the evolutionary paths of Earth and its sister planet. This study addresses a long-standing question regarding the solar system's planetary formations.
